As an FYI, the last time the HTs were Motrorolla XPR 6580s which were in
fair used condition (old municipal radios). They came with a charger,
handmic, battery, and they were programmed for local New England 900 Mhz
repeaters. Neither the handmic or battery had any guarantee on longevity.
Both of mine have been fine but I haven't used the HT for long stints so I
have no idea the battery life. The cost last time was estimated to be
$35-$40 and ended up being $35. New batteries are available online with
USB-C charging ports and I know some folks ordered those.
